Job description

JOB TITLE: Project Manager

DEPARTMENT: Professional Services

REPORTS TO: Senior Project Manager (UK & I )

LOCATION: Remote / Leeds Hybrid

KEY PURPOSE OF ROLE

Manage the activities on any project for an assigned customer (Software Development, hardware & Software Installations, software support), ensuring the cooperation of the various departments within the organisation. Preparing and setting up project documentation and leading the implementation of the project, within preconditions of costs, quality, time, organisation and communication, in such a way that the formulated project objectives are realised.

Key accountabilities:

  • Responsible for the delivery of the project objectives by the project team by being proactive through leadership and mentoring while adhering to the approved project finances.
  • Providing guidance and support to project members to promote collaboration.
  • Ensure an optimisation of the cooperation of the various departments within the organisation.
  • Drawing up the project plan (project definition, project objectives and a program of requirements) and plan of approach. Obtaining approval for project documents.
  • Realising the implementation of the project plan, as well as providing periodic reports in accordance with agreed project objectives and results.
  • Managing project team within the project scope. Define preconditions with regard to commitment to achieving the (project) objectives.
  • Project completion, testing the delivered project results against the project plan and, after achieving the desired project objectives, transferring relevant knowledge and documents to the operational departments (service, product specialists, etc.).
  • Make proposals for process and product improvement with the aim of improving the quality of the delivered process and product for future projects, products and services.
  • Monitoring and promoting coherence between different and interconnected projects/products.
  • Performing all other activities that are determined by / in consultation with the manager.

PERSON SPECIFICATION
Essential:

  • Proactive, flexible, good customer facing skills & good with technical teams
  • Management of internal and external suppliers
  • Adaptable to a fast-moving retail environment
  • Used to troubleshooting and reacting to issues as they appear
  • Good commercial awareness
  • Microsoft Office (Excel, Project)

Desirable:

  • Prince 2 (Foundation / Practitioner)
  • Retail Project Management
  • Management of large scale software and hardware rollouts
